Textpattern Admin Plug-ins
Impatience has gotten the best of me. Too much time has passed with no noticeable progress towards the 1.0 release, despite it being slated for release in 4 days. The biggest piece lacking from Textpattern is an plug-in api for the Admin interface. This has required mods for any changes to the admin side of things. I like mods, but it takes a lot more work to document and they are harder to install to an already modded installation. It’s extra work for everyone, so I don’t like it.
A few months back, zem created a mod that allowed for basic admin plug-ins. It never really caught on and is not in the code base. It is a decent implementation so I will do my part and help it along. I modded the latest textpattern code (1.0rc2 rev 61) with these changes. I also created a plug-in that can be used as an example. I plan on porting many of my existing mods to work as plug-ins. Dean, if this conflicts with something you have planned for the 1.0 release, sorry.
